1) Alamosa Cover with Contents on Buying and Selling Mining Property. Dated 1885; six years after a post office was granted. Includes a letter on the mines in the Music Pass District. Letter is addressed to lawyer Nat. Nathan and is from EH Strong. Strong notes that his partner, CF Holby, had passed away and the he, Strong, had the rights to several mines in the district. Letter has been transcribed in full and makes very interesting reading. Cover has a corner Advertisement for JA Gale in Alamosa. Addressed to Nat. Nathan. Date Oct. 30th, 1885. 2) 1890 Alamosa cover. Corner advertising of the Perry House, H Bachus proprietor. Dated Sep. 12, 1890. Strong strike and cancel.
